  2. Jul 8, 2019 · Each day starts with 15 minutes of independent reading. Then, I teach the mini-lesson/skill of focus. I use a mentor text and do whatever I expect the kids to do. This typically takes anywhere from 10-20 minutes. Usually, students then go off to do the skill with a partner. This is about 10 minutes.
